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
385384 4970744209 357214327 45324 09943487686
2496977 09948 25239003
2496977 09948 25239003
38745163 950274 243498649
All about undefined
Interested in learning more?
2496977 09948 25239003
38745163 950274 243498649
See more
629 69
68751 295 499 816727585
See more
3575479 2986
9572 776 3183514524 974
See more